I'd check with your states DMV codes.  Here in MO, if you have turn signals, they have to function.  You don't actually need them to pass the safety inspection.  Same with a stop lamp, if the bike is equipped with one, it has to work.

in PA, blinkers are blinkers. in fact, you don't even have to have them. but if you DO have them, you have to have both front AND rear... and they have to be a certain width apart, so as not to confuse oncoming idio... i mean traffic ;D
